What is the Tax Preparers Professional Liability Application?
The Tax Preparers Professional Liability Application is a crucial document that facilitates tax preparers in acquiring professional liability insurance. This specialized insurance protects tax preparers from potential claims resulting from errors or omissions in their work. Understanding this application's purpose is essential for ensuring compliance and safeguarding against financial risks associated with tax preparation.

Key Features of the Tax Preparers Professional Liability Application
The application includes essential fields that require detailed information about the tax preparation business, such as employee details and compliance with professional standards. Additionally, it addresses any previous losses incurred, which helps in assessing the risk associated with insuring the business. Notably, the application mandates the applicant's signature, emphasizing the importance of accountability in the insurance process.
Who Should Use the Tax Preparers Professional Liability Application?
This application is designed for a broad audience within the tax preparation industry. Independent tax preparers, larger tax preparation firms, and tax consultants should all consider applying for this insurance, especially those who regularly handle complex tax situations. It is advisable to utilize the application as soon as the preparer begins to establish their business or takes on new clients that introduce additional liabilities.

Who is eligible to apply with this form?
Any tax preparation firm, independent tax preparer, or accounting professional looking for professional liability insurance is eligible to use the Tax Preparers Professional Liability Application.
What information do I need before filling out the application?
You will need details about your business operations, employee count, types of tax returns prepared, prior losses, and compliance details with continuing education requirements.

Are there any deadlines for submitting this form?
While specific deadlines may vary based on the insurance provider, it is advisable to submit the application well in advance of your insurance expiration date to ensure uninterrupted coverage.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the form?
Common mistakes include leaving required fields blank, providing incorrect or inconsistent information, and failing to sign and date the application, which could delay processing.
What happens after I submit my application?
After submission, your application will undergo processing by the insurance provider, who may contact you for additional information or clarification before making a coverage decision.
Is notarization required for this application?
No, notarization is not required for the Tax Preparers Professional Liability Application; however, it must be signed by the applicant.
